QUOTE(puchongite @ Apr 10 2019, 04:37 PM)
If you found any good airmouse, let us know.

The air mouse are typically like shits :-

1) They drink battery like drinking water.

2) Constantly have to toggle between remote/IR mode vs usb-dongle (airmouse) mode. And then make to toggle between mouse mode vs non-mouse mode.

I doubt people understand all those things.

Yes, IR remote has to transmit IR vendor ID over which matches the box to be controlled. Without "learning", it is tight to a particular box. I am not sure if the minix remote can learn new IR code or not.
*
I'm shopping for remote control for my Shield TV too.
I much have the following features:
1) Gyroscope Air mouse
2) Bluetooth ( to free up USB port )
3) Voice control.
4) keyboard is not a must but bonus if comes with it.

From my research thus far, I've found Q5 remote control meet the first three conditions.
